The most common type of skin psoriasis is plaque psoriasis. The skin is red and covered with grey or silver scales and inflamed. also patches of circular to oval sahaped red plaques that are itchy or burn. Normally the patches are found on the elbows and knees, but may be found on any part of the skin. Psoriasis can be inherited but is not contagious. There is a big difference between Chin Chin and Garra Rufa.Chin Chin are actually small versions of Tilapia which is a type of Cichlid fish. When they reach about 6cm they can cause to your skin.Garra Rufas are toothless and are totally harmless .Google the 2 fish to see the obvious differences BEFORE going into any fish spa.
